Understanding Doors and Windows: An In-Depth Overview

Doors and windows are crucial elements of both domestic and commercial architecture, serving numerous functional and visual functions. They offer security, enable natural light, help with ventilation, and enhance the general look of a structure. Kinds of Doors and Windows

Types of Doors

Doors come in numerous styles, each conference specific requirements and choices. Here are some of the most common types:

  1. Hinged Doors: Traditional doors that swing open and closed on hinges. These can be interior or exterior doors.
  2. Sliding Doors: Doors that slide along a track, often used for outdoor patio gain access to and supplying a modern-day look.
  3. Bi-fold Doors: Made up of a number of hinged panels that fold against one another. Ideal for broad openings to produce an open living space.
  4. French Doors: Often used as outdoor patio doors, they include 2 panels that swing open, allowing plenty of light and a clear view of the outdoors.
  5. Pocket Doors: A sliding door that disappears into a wall cavity, saving space where a swinging door might be not practical.
  6. Garage Doors: Available in numerous styles, including roller, sectional, and tilt-up alternatives, functioning as the entryway to garages.

Types of Windows

Windows also are available in numerous styles and materials, each offering special benefits. Secret types include:

  1. Double-Hung Windows: Traditional windows with two operable sashes that move up and down.
  2. Casement Windows: Windows that are depended upon one side and open outside, permitting for maximum ventilation.
  3. Awning Windows: Similar to casement windows but hinged at the top, opening outward and perfect for rainy environments.
  4. Photo Windows: Fixed windows that offer extensive views without the capability to open.
  5. Bay and Bow Windows: Protruding windows that create extra interior space, commonly discovered in living rooms.
  6. Skylights: Installed in roofing systems to enable natural light into upper levels of homes or structures.

Materials for Doors and Windows

The materials used in windows and doors considerably affect their durability, maintenance requirements, and insulation homes. Typical materials include:

Material Description Pros Cons
Wood Timeless choice, available in numerous designs Visually pleasing, good insulator Needs regular maintenance, vulnerable to rot
Vinyl Made from PVC, versatile and low-maintenance Energy-efficient, resistant to moisture Restricted styles compared to wood
Aluminum Lightweight and strong Long lasting, corrosion-resistant Poor insulator without thermal breaks
Fiberglass Composite product, can imitate wood Highly resilient, energy-efficient More pricey upfront
Steel Strong and safe and secure Fire-resistant, ideal for security Prone to rust if not correctly dealt with

Advantages of Doors and Windows

Security

Today's innovative locking systems and hard materials increase the security of windows and doors. Homeowners can choose strengthened glass, multi-point lock systems, and clever technology to make sure assurance.

Energy Efficiency

Energy-efficient windows and doors can significantly reduce heating & cooling expenses. Features like double-glazing, low-E coverings, and appropriate insulation minimize energy intake, causing lower utility bills.

Visual Appeal

The option of doors and windows profoundly affects a structure's look. They can enhance the architectural style, offer a focal point, and enhance the total curb appeal.

Comfort

Appropriately designed windows and doors contribute to indoor convenience by managing temperature and air flow. They facilitate natural ventilation and guarantee adequate lighting without compromising personal privacy.

Installation and Maintenance

Appropriate installation and routine upkeep of doors and windows are vital for maximizing their durability and performance.

Setup Steps

  1. Procedure: Accurate measurements make sure a perfect fit.
  2. Select Materials: Consider toughness, style, and energy performance.
  3. Prepare the Opening: Ensure the structural integrity of the surrounding framework.
  4. Position the Door/Window: Set the unit within the ready opening, making sure level and plumb alignment.
  5. Secure in Place: Use screws and brackets to secure securely.
  6. Insulate and Seal: Apply weather-stripping and caulk to avoid air leaks.
  7. Finish: Install any extra trims and finish the interior/exterior finishes.

Maintenance Tips

  • Routine Cleaning: Clean glass surface areas with appropriate cleaners to preserve clarity.
  • Inspect Seals: Regularly look for gaps in seals and weather removing.
  • Lubricate Hardware: Keep hinges, locks, and sliding parts well-lubricated to prevent rust and ensure smooth operation.
  • Look for Damage: Look for indications of rot, rust, or disrepair, and address them immediately.
